Full title and description

ASTM E1065/E1065M-20(2025) — Standard Practice for Evaluating Characteristics of Ultrasonic Search Units. This practice provides standardized measurement procedures for characterizing the acoustic and electrical responses of single‑element piezoelectric ultrasonic search units (probes) used with ultrasonic testing instrumentation; it is intended to supply data from which performance and acceptance criteria may be developed but does not itself prescribe acceptance limits.

Abstract

This standard describes procedures and test methods to obtain performance data for ultrasonic search units, including frequency and time response, beam profiling, focal point and depth of field determinations, and electrical characteristics. Procedures are applicable to bench or laboratory characterization systems and to commercial search‑unit characterization equipment. Annexes cover a range of measurement methods and frequency bands (general annexes A1–A6 for ~0.4–10 MHz, A7 for higher‑frequency immersion units, A8 for sound beam profiling in metals). The practice treats SI and inch‑pound units separately.

Scope

This practice covers measurement procedures for evaluating certain characteristics of ultrasonic search units used with ultrasonic testing instrumentation. It describes methods to obtain acoustic and electrical performance data for individual search units (separate from the instrument), and is applicable to incoming inspection, manufacturing acceptance, and periodic evaluation during service life. The procedures in the normative annexes are generally applicable to search units operating in the 0.4 MHz to 10 MHz range; supplementary annexes address higher‑frequency immersion units and beam profiling in metals. The practice is not intended to set pass/fail criteria; rather it provides standardized data from which acceptance criteria can be established.

Key topics and requirements

  • Standardized procedures for measurement of acoustic parameters (beam profile, focal point, depth of field, sound pressure distribution).
  • Frequency and time response characterization, including peak frequency and bandwidth.
  • Electrical characterization of search units (impedance, electrical response) when used separately from instruments.
  • Annexed methods for immersion testing and beam profiling in metal; guidance on test setups and instrumentation (signal generators, pulsers, amplifiers, digitizers, oscilloscopes, waveform analyzers).
  • Dual‑unit approach (SI and inch‑pound systems are specified separately and are not to be combined).
  • Intended for single‑element piezoelectric search units; implementation may require facility‑specific procedural detail.

Typical use and users

Used by nondestructive testing (NDT) laboratories, ultrasonic probe manufacturers, quality assurance and incoming inspection teams, calibration laboratories, research and development groups working on ultrasonic transducers, and organizations that maintain ultrasonic testing assets. Typical applications include manufacturing acceptance testing, periodic performance verification of probes in service, and laboratory characterization for probe selection and development.
